Dash of Salt and Pepper Diner — Restaurant in Chicago

Name
Dash of Salt and Pepper Diner
Description
Basic set-up for American comfort foods from an open kitchen line with coffee in funky digs.

This place was what our neighborhood has always been missing - an outstanding, friendly and very tasty diner! I had a baby right before the pandemic began, so I was in lockdown with a newborn. This was great at first, but sometimes you really need to get out! So when Chicago started opening up again, this became my place very quickly. The staff is friendly and helpful whether I am juggling a baby while I am trying to eat or I am sitting for hours drinking coffee while working. When I heard that indoor dining was closing, I went there everyday I could to support them, and now I try to stop in regularly for coffee and a donut or takeout. They have great coffee - Dark Matter. Food-wise, they carry Do Rite donuts, which are the best. They have the BEST corned beef hash I have ever had. I probably eat it once a week. Besides that, I really like their Dash-wich breakfast sandwich and my husband loves the Route 66 Burrito.

Right now, Dash is a Christmas wonderland with a tree, Christmas Village, local goods for purchase, and lots of decorations.

This place is amazing, and it is just what the neighborhood needs. The owners and whole staff are so friendly and it truly feels like home! I really encourage everyone to try it and...
